What we believe

The operating system of trusted AI execution

Three convictions shape everything we build.

01

AI will act, not just answer

The shift from chat to execution is already underway. The question is no longer capability — it’s control.

02

Trust is infrastructure

Governance can’t live in a PDF policy. It has to run in the execution path, per action, in real time.

03

Humans stay in the loop — by design

When policy calls for human approval, an authorized reviewer decides with full context, and that sign-off becomes part of the record. Human judgment is a designed seat in the authorization loop, not an afterthought.

From the founder

Why we're building Crelis

Every enterprise I speak to is racing to put AI agents to work — and every serious one asks the same question a few weeks in: who, actually, authorized that action? Not what the model said. What it did.

We started Crelis on a conviction: the final authority over a consequential action can never be the intelligence that proposed it. Authority has to be independent, deterministic, and provable — a control you can hand to your risk team, your auditor, and your regulator without asking them to trust a black box.

That is what we're building: runtime authorization for AI agents, as an independent authority layer. We're doing it openly, with design partners — in shadow mode first, then advisory, earning enforcement one decision at a time.
